Company's mission is 'To provide customized logistics solutions through superior customer service, expertise in global trade, and a commitment to quality and integrity.'

Expeditors International mission emphasizes high-touch logistics expertise, asset-light operations, and consistent quality-driven customer service focused on profitable, sustainable growth.

Icon

Main purpose: Enable efficient global trade

The mission directs the firm to simplify cross-border trade and optimize supply chains via consulting, customs brokerage, and tailored freight solutions.

Icon

Primary focus: Customers and trade partners

The mission centers on customers and partners, aiming to reduce friction in international logistics and protect clients' supply chain continuity.

Icon

Promised value: Expertise, flexibility, and integrity

Expeditors promises operational agility, regulatory know-how, and trustworthy service that drive lower risk and higher margin outcomes for clients.

Icon

Distinctiveness: Specific and strategic

The mission is company-specific: it highlights an asset-light, knowledge-first model rather than generic logistics platitudes.

What the Company Says It Stands For: Expeditors International stands for a high-touch, asset-light service model prioritizing expertise over owned transport assets; by March 2026 it emphasizes high-margin customs brokerage and supply-chain consulting while maintaining strong financial discipline (FY2025 revenue about $17.3 billion, net income $1.6 billion, operating margin near 9%).

Company's vision is 'To be the premier global logistics organization.'

Expeditors describes a future of disciplined, organic global expansion with unified technology and culture enabling real-time visibility and predictive logistics.

Icon

Unified, Visible Global Network

The long-term outcome is a single global operations platform that delivers end-to-end visibility for customers and consistent service across markets.

Icon

Scale: Global Leadership

The vision targets leadership in global logistics through organic network density rather than rapid M&A, emphasizing worldwide reach and local consistency.

Icon

Ambition: Pragmatic and Focused

The ambition reads as realistic and focused: measurable tech-driven gains in visibility and efficiency rather than aspirational platitudes.

Icon

Fit with Current Strategy

The vision aligns with Expeditors International corporate strategy of organic growth, integrated IT investment, and steady margin preservation seen in recent results.

How the Company Describes Its Future

To be the premier global logistics organization. The future described by Expeditors International is one of disciplined, organic expansion rather than growth through aggressive acquisitions. This vision is characterized by a commitment to building a unified global network from the ground up, ensuring that every office operates on the same technology platform and shares the same corporate culture. For the 2025-2026 period, this future-looking strategy focuses on 'digital orchestration,' where the company aims to integrate real-time sensor data and predictive analytics into its core service offering to provide customers with unprecedented visibility into their global inventories.

Expeditors International emphasizes discipline, integrity, curiosity and excellence across ten stated cultural elements, guiding a debt – averse capital policy, strict compliance, customer – first problem diagnosis, and high operational standards.

IconDiscipline and Financial Prudence

Shows in a $0 long – term debt stance and conservative capital allocation, prioritizing free cash flow and returning value to shareholders over dilutive M&A.

IconIntegrity and Compliance

Operates an industry – leading compliance program – critical for customs and trade regulation – reducing legal and operational risk in global freight forwarding.

IconCuriosity-Driven Customer Focus

Encourages deep understanding of client supply chains before proposing solutions, improving win rates and reducing execution errors in logistics projects.

IconExcellence and Operational Rigor

Prioritizes process discipline and measurable KPIs – on – time delivery, claims ratio, and contract margin – shaping a performance – oriented culture.

What Principles It Claims to Follow: Expeditors International operates under ten core cultural elements including appearance, attitude, confidence, curiosity, discipline, excellence, humility, integrity, pride, and resilience; discipline shows in a debt – free balance sheet and avoidance of dilutive M&A, while integrity is enforced via a rigorous compliance program and curiosity drives deep customer discovery to tailor logistics solutions. Expeditors International's stated ideas show up in pay and performance: profit-sharing at the branch level ties employee rewards to operating income, and the firm's operations kept a 30 percent operating margin on net revenue in 2025 while expanding organically to over 300 global locations by 2026.

Icon

Products and Services: Integrated freight and logistics solutions

Expeditors International mission appears in tailored supply – chain services and customs brokerage that prioritize accuracy and low claims rates, reflecting Expeditors core values and culture in client deliverables.

Icon

Strategy and Expansion Choices: Organic, margin – focused growth

Expeditors corporate strategy favors opening new offices internally rather than acquisitions, supporting long – term resilience and aligning with the Expeditors International vision of consistent, disciplined expansion.

Icon

Operations and Execution: Standardized processes and accountability

Operational playbooks, real – time visibility tools, and branch profit responsibility enforce the leadership principle that execution drives profitability and customer trust.

Icon

Culture and People: Profit – sharing and performance ownership

The profit – sharing incentive ties employee pay to branch operating income, embodying Expeditors mission statement for employee engagement and reinforcing quality in people as a core hiring and retention lever.

Icon

Customer Experience or Public Actions: Reliable, low – risk service delivery

Consistent margins and claims discipline translate to predictable service levels, showing how Expeditors core values impact customer service and external communications.

Icon

Strongest Real – World Example: Branch profit sharing and margins

Expeditors International uses plain, direct language across its public messaging to stress operational reliability, financial strength, and leadership tenure; filings and investor materials foreground steady dividend growth and a debt-free balance sheet as proof points.

IconWebsite and Official Messaging

Expeditors International mission and Expeditors International vision appear plainly on corporate pages, investor relations, and SEC filings, emphasizing a debt-free balance sheet and 40+ years of service as core credibility signals.

IconLeadership and Investor Communication

Executive letters and the 2025 annual report repeat the same themes – stability, consistent dividend increases (dividend raised annually for over 40 years) and conservative capital allocation – aligning Expeditors corporate strategy with investor expectations.

IconEmployee and Culture Communication

Hiring materials and internal communications highlight Expeditors core values and culture, tenure-based promotion, and leadership development as practical examples of Expeditors mission statement for employee engagement and commitment to quality in people.

IconConsistency Across Touchpoints

Messaging is consistent: public filings, website copy, and investor decks all reinforce the same Expeditors leadership principles and company values examples, stressing reliability over flashy tech narratives.
